About Veritau
Veritau provides assurance services to local authorities, schools and other public sector clients, helping our clients to operate effectively, mitigate risks and comply with laws and regulations.
Our main services include internal audit, counter fraud, information governance and risk management. We’re owned by our member councils, meaning our work sits at the heart of the public sector. Our head office is in York, but we provide services across the country.

We are looking for an Information Access Officer to support our public sector clients to manage and respond to Freedom of Information and Subject Access requests. This role sits within Veritau’s Information Governance team.
You will assist in the delivery of high quality services to our clients. The role includes providing advice and guidance to clients, coordinating responses, updating systems and preparing reports. You will also regularly communicate with those people and organisations requesting information.
Candidates should have administrative experience, preferably gained within the public sector. Experience of handling Freedom of Information and Subject Access requests would be an advantage, but training will be provided if required.
We’re looking for applicants who can manage their own time, develop good working relationships with clients, and have good organisational and communication skills.
The package includes membership of a generous pension scheme and 28 days annual leave plus bank holidays, rising to 30 days after five years of service.
